Optimize Your Video for YouTube Search
YouTube is the second largest search engine in the world, right behind Google. That means people are actively searching for videos every second.
If your video isn’t optimized, you’re basically hiding it from those searches.
Make sure you:
- Use clear keywords in the title
- Write a useful video description
- Add relevant tags
- Create a thumbnail people actually want to click

Share Your Video on Communities
Another free promotion strategy is sharing your video where people already hang out online.
Places like:
- Reddit communities
- Discord servers
- Facebook groups
- niche forums
But there’s an important rule here.
Don’t be the person who shows up, drops a link, and disappears.
Nobody likes that person.
Engage with the community first, contribute to discussions, and then share your video when it’s genuinely relevant.
How to Promote a YouTube Video on Instagram
Instagram can be surprisingly powerful if you know how to use it.
If you want to promote a YouTube video on Instagram, the trick is not to post the entire video, it’s to create curiosity.
A few ideas:
Post a short teaser Reel
Show the most interesting moment from the video and leave viewers wanting more.
Use Instagram Stories
Add a quick description and direct people to your YouTube link.
Put your YouTube link in your bio
Then remind viewers where they can watch the full video.
Short-form content can act like a movie trailer. If it’s intriguing enough, viewers will head over to YouTube to watch the full story.

YouTube Studio Promote Video Feature
You may have noticed a “Promote” button inside YouTube Studio.
This feature allows creators to run advertising campaigns directly from their channel dashboard.
The YouTube Studio promote video feature works by creating Google Ads campaigns that display your video to targeted viewers.
It’s simple to set up, which is great for beginners.
But there’s a catch.
Running effective ads is a bit like cooking without a recipe. If you don’t know what you’re doing, you might spend money… and end up with very little to show for it.
Using Google Ads to Promote a YouTube Video
Many creators also choose to promote YouTube videos using Google Ads.
With Google Ads, your video can appear as:
- Skippable ads before other videos
- Suggested videos in search results
- Discovery ads on YouTube’s homepage
You can target audiences based on:
- interests
- location
- demographics
- search behaviour
It’s powerful, but it also comes with a learning curve.
And a budget.
